## Reseller Programme — Managers Only

Quick refresher on the Brightvale Partner Track: resellers who clear two quarters at Silver tier get co-marketing funds and early access to the Lumo range. Branch managers should vet applicants locally before head office sign-off — we've had a few tyre-kickers lately. Margins stay at the standard schedule until the Keswick-on-Marsh pilot wraps up. Don't share tier thresholds externally. Before briefing your teams, note the following confidential point on our plans.

internal memo for kawip-hadug: Headcount on the Wenwyn team goes from 7 to 140 by the end of January. Gross margin on Wenwyn came in at 20 percent against a plan of 15 percent.

Capacity note for the Meridell dedupe rollout: the matcher scans roughly 2.1M customer records per batch, and memory scales with the candidate-pair window. Current staging hosts handle the load at 70% utilization, leaving headroom for one more tenant. No hardware changes needed this quarter. The constants we plan to ship in the next release are listed here.

limits module of fajog-tawig:
RATE_LIMITS = {
    "druwyn": 2,
    "quenael": 10,
    "wenix": 2,
    "druael": 2,
}

Welcome to on-call for Gridleaf's CSV Import Wizard. The wizard stages uploads in the holding bucket, validates headers, then commits rows to the ledger service. If a commit stalls past ten minutes, restart the staging worker before escalating. Restarting requires unlocking the wizard's sealed config, which is protected by a recovery passphrase. The passphrase you will need is listed directly below.

recovery phrase for bawep-kawef: oliath-casdor